NSA Security Guide for RHEL5

The NSA have published a 170-page security configuration guide for RHEL5. It’s a kind of best practices document for security, with step-by-step explanations for locking down pretty much every feature of the OS.

I’d say this is essential reading for anyone deploying RHEL or similar (Fedora, CentOS etc.) distributions, and likely also quite useful in the general case.
